Updating account information

Keep contact, ownership, and tax details current with MShore

Accurate records protect your access to Online Banking and help payments clear without unnecessary holds. You should update postal and email addresses, phone numbers, beneficial ownership, and tax residency information as soon as they change.

Some updates can be started in the client portal; others require supporting documents reviewed by Support. Out-of-date information can delay wires, card renewals, or portal actions until verification is complete.

  • Contact details: email and phone must be reachable for security alerts and one-time codes.
  • Address changes: may require recent proof of address before statements and correspondence are redirected.
  • Ownership changes: beneficial owners and authorised signatories must be re-documented promptly.
  • Tax residency changes: update self-certification so FATCA/CRS reporting remains accurate.
  • Name changes: usually need certified legal evidence before we reissue cards or amend payment profiles.
